The Punjab Chief Minister Shahbaz Sharif said on Friday that negative attitude of the people doing falsehood politics, anarchy and allegations, has pernicious effect on democracy and the democratic institutions. "Enough is enough, now the sit-in group will not be allowed to play with the destiny of the country," Shahbaz said, adding, "An effort was made to hit the journey of national development through plunder, sit-ins and lockdown and even the national interest was jeopardized. In the backdrop of ongoing international situation, Pakistan cannot tolerate negative politics any way."
He said the elements engaged in politics of criticism should fully understand that country makes progress when practical steps are taken with the commitment of public service. The elements opposing the development projects aimed at public welfare have lost respect in the eyes of the people and the vision of PML-N government is public service.
Shahbaz maintained that the defeated political elements should realize facts.
He lamented that past rulers left no stone unturned to plunder in their tenure and added that persons looting the national resources mercilessly by expanding their network of corruption could not be loyal to the nation.
He further said that whenever Pakistan Muslim League-N came into power, it did the politics of public welfare and national development. Due to our sincere efforts and untiring hard work, the country has moved towards development and prosperity today and the quality of life of the people is much better than before. A mammoth public mandate will be won by the PML-N in the elections of 2018, he claimed.
